> On Wed, 2017-10-11 at 06:50 +0000, Joakim Tjernlund wrote:
> > Could we add the possibility to Edit the response so you can send a
> > msg to the organiser ?
> 
>         Hi,
> in case of EWS servers it's the server sending the response, not
> evolution-ews. If I recall correctly, there is no parameter in the EWS
> protocol to add a message to the response. Users can edit, or even
> decide whether to send the response to the organizer, when it's managed
> by Evolution itself.
